Analyse the extent of the relationships shown in Figure 3a and Figure 3b. Figure 3a shows annual mean temperatures in Australia in 2018 compared to historical tempe... show full transcript

There is some evidence of correlation between temperature and rainfall in 2018. Specifically, areas suffering from high temperatures, such as New South Wales, experienced lower than average rainfall. This suggests that higher temperatures may lead to drier conditions in these regions.

However, not all areas align with this trend. For instance, parts of Queensland recorded high temperatures but also reported averages or higher rainfall. This indicates an exception to the general pattern observed across the majority of Australia.

In contrast, Southern Australia generally presented cooler temperatures with varying rainfall levels, showing that temperature patterns do not uniformly dictate rainfall across all regions.

Overall, while there are noticeable correlations between the annual mean temperatures and rainfall, the data exhibits anomalies that reveal complex interactions. It suggests that several factors influence weather patterns beyond just one parameter, highlighting the need for further analysis to fully understand these relationships.
